| Characteristics | Value |
|---|---|
| Product category | Module |
| Dimensions (length/ width / height) | 1956x992x35 mm |
| Weight (kg) | 22,20 |
| Technology | Polycrystalline |
| Number of cells | 72 |
| Glass type | 3.2 mm |
| Rear side | White Backsheet |
| Frame | Aluminum grey |
| Connectors | MC4 or equivalent |
| Junction box | IP68 |
| Numbre of diodes | 3 |
| Maximum Load (Pa) | 2400 / 5400 |
| Standard cable length | Custom (default 1.2 m) |
| Hail resistance | 25mm (IEC 61215) |

GCL is a key player in the solar industry.
It is one of the world's Top 3 polysilicon manufacturers and a leading supplier of wafers and modules.
In 2022, the manufacturer will have a PV module production capacity of 19 GW. This will rise to 30 GW by the end of 2023.
The group is also a power producer with the accumulative installed capacity of GCL-ET by now, in operation and under construction, exceeding 4,000 MW (not including the proposed projects), over 90% of which is new clean energy.
GCL is at the forefront in each of the production stages of PV modules and stand out by its technological advantages. The manufacturer has a vertically integrated photovoltaic industrial chain.
